{- Create a JSON string from Dhall `Text` ``` let JSON = ./package.dhall in JSON.render (JSON.string "ABC $ \" 🙂") = "\"ABC \\u0024 \\\" 🙂\"" let JSON = ./package.dhall in JSON.render (JSON.string "") = "\"\"" ``` -} let JSON = ./Type sha256:5adb234f5868a5b0eddeb034d690aaba8cb94ea20d0d557003e90334fff6be3e ? ./Type let string : Text → JSON = λ(x : Text) → λ(JSON : Type) → λ ( json : { string : Text → JSON , number : Double → JSON , object : List { mapKey : Text, mapValue : JSON } → JSON , array : List JSON → JSON , bool : Bool → JSON , null : JSON } ) → json.string x in string